The Millennials, or today's twenty-somethings, have been called the toughest generation to manage. They have a reputation for being spoiled and demanding, and not particularly self-directed or loyal. But they are the future of your organization, and if you want to remain competitive, you must do what it takes to recruit and retain them, and learn how to work with them.Millennials offer the corporate world enormous energy and talent. As a group they are social, technologically skilled, eager, achievement-oriented, and they love a challenge. However, channeling those positive attributes will take a patient, nurturing approach.'#MILLENNIALtweet Book01' is a book that was written to be digested quickly and easily by today's busy manager who doesn't have time to spend weeks or months learning how to supervise today's young professionals. It provides understanding and tools that can be implemented instantly to assist in making the twenty-something employees more effective.'#MILLENNIALtweet Book01' is part of the THINKaha series whose 100-page books contain 140 well-thought-out quotes (tweets/ahas).
